If you are using TurboTax Online you can only prepare and file one return per account. If you need to prepare another return, another account will need to be used/created. You can create up to 5 accounts with the same email address.
If you are using TurboTax Desktop you can prepare and e-file up to 5 federal returns and you can prepare 1 state return (there is an additional fee to e-file the state return).
Everyone pays the 24.99 state efile fee, even the first one. Are they doing a state return in the same state as you?
You get one free state PROGRAM download to prepare unlimited state returns. Then each state return (including the first one) is 19.99 to efile, usually goes up to 24.99 March 1. Or you can print and mail state for free.
